Clinical Training and Procedural Prowess
Hands-on experience forms the backbone of the Columbia GI Fellowship. Fellows rotate through some of the busiest and most sophisticated gastroenterology units in New York City, gaining unparalleled experience in diagnostic and therapeutic endoscopy. The volume and variety of cases ensure that participants master essential skills, including endoscopic mucosal resection, endoscopic submucosal dissection, and management of complex biliary and pancreatic disorders. This immersive clinical environment is designed to build competence and confidence, allowing fellows to refine their technique under the guidance of nationally recognized experts in the field.
